Ms. Silvia Poletti contributed to "Let's Talk(BBS)" about the
Cagliari tour of Hamburg Ballet as follows:
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
Sorry for my delay in reporting the terrific success of HB in Cagliari,
Sardinia, Italy, during the season of 7 performances of R&J. All the
company was absolutely outstanding and so lively and 'true' that the drama
seemed to develop naturally as the response of immediate facts and reactions.
Silvia Azzoni absolutely marvellous: a sublime Juliet, so tiny she is so
great she appears on the stage. I loved also the different, fresh Juliet
of Helene Bouchet, with Thiago Bordin as her young and bold Romeo. In so
a different way Ivan Urban and Carsten Jung were a wild 'Prince of Cats
Tybalt' but Sacha Riabko literally stole the show with his Mercutio's death.
It was so powerful and dramatic, and moving that public was overwhelmed
and nobody (more or less) stood up from his own seat during the following
intermission. Everyone wanted to stay and continue feeling the strong emotions.
Massimo Murru, guest of HB, with complete devotion put himself in Neumeier's
hands to create Romeo. A sensitive dancer, he grow performance after perfomance.
I hear Neumeier was satisfied by his way to work. A wonderful tour to Sardinia,
indeed, against all the strikes and bad weather Italy reserved me in those
days.

Fri. 6. Jan. 2006
Have you watched ( and listen to ) the New Year's Concert of the Vienna
Philharmonic on TV?
Ballet pieces choreographed by John Neumeier were fascinating. In my regret,
there was no credits about dancers. They were superb. I write down about
that.
Johann Strauss: "Neue Pizzicato-Polka", op. 449
Thiago Bordin, Alexandre Riabko, Silvia Azzoni
( in appearence order )
Johann Strauss: "Du und Du", Walzer, op. 367
Ivan Urban, Anna Polikarpova ( in appearence order
), Dancers of Volks Oper Wien and Wiener Staatsopernballet
